Wealthy women were able to buy imported makeup from china & germany while the poorer women could only afford the cheaper knock offs. Highly colored preparations of the lips,cheeks and eyes were discovered during the renaissance. During the renaissances, women shaved their eyebrows and hairlines to appear more intelligent. Men and Women in the renaissances bleach their hair blonde, saffron or onion skin dye or in case of italian women they sat in the sun for hours with a crownless hat. The puritanical Victorian era advocated a modest, natural beauty, restrained and without makeup. Victorian women pinched their cheeks and bit lips for color to induce natural color rather than cosmetics. Only women that wore makeup were prostitute and actresses, who only wore makeup on stage. In the 1840s woman hair were sleek and modest the hair was oiled down with big curls at the side.
